sealer1

Syllabification: (seal·er)
Pronunciation: /ˈsēlər/

Definition of sealer

noun

  • 1a device or substance used to seal something, especially with a hermetic or an impervious seal.
  • 2 (also sealer jar) Canadian a jar with a hermetic seal designed to preserve food such as fruit, pickles, and jams.
